I used to think: Yoga props are for beginner. And the arrogant me never touched props (like blocks and strap) until the day I pulled my muscle during a yoga practice and realised I was so wrong.
And I learn that when I come to yoga, I better put my ego at home. Props like blocks and straps support the practice in so many ways even though we may think we don’t need them. I love using props to stretch, to help me overcome my fear of falling, to enter a new pose that may require different muscles that have rarely been used.
Below are my favourite position to open my heart and shoulders, as well as support my back bending and stretching my core. The feeling is out of this world soothing and relaxing!!

When it comes to difficult asanas in Yoga, arm balancing poses and inversion poses (head below heart) are at the top of the list. Because they require not just strength, not just flexibility, but the courage and determination to get to them. No one is born with the strength and flexibility. It takes hard work, dedication and most importantly the correct training method to prevent injury and optimise your capability.
If you want to start, like the most experience yogi somehwere, hit me up and ask for tips. The first one is, START with basic 😊.
